  • In this work we have investigated the feasibility of virus clearance by flocculation and tangential flow microfiltration. Chinese hamster ovary cell feed streams were spiked with minute virus of mice and then flocculated using cationic polyelectrolytes prior to tangential flow microfiltration. Our results indicate that flocculation prior to microfiltration leads to more than 100 fold clearance of minute virus of mice particles in the permeate. Today, validation of virus clearance is a major concern in the manufacture of biopharmaceutical products. Frequently new unit operations are added simply to validate virus clearance thus increasing the manufacturing cost. The results obtained here suggest that virus clearance can be obtained during tangential flow microfiltration. Since tangential flow microfiltration is frequently used for bioreactor harvesting this could be a low cost method to validate virus clearance.

  • For a vertical type crankshaft-journal bearing system used in scroll compressor, nonlinear transient response analysis is applied includung nonlinear fluid film reaction forces of journal beatings. By a connected behavior analysis of crankshaft and orbiting scroll, the radial clearance of scroll wraps is calculated. Considering tangential leakage for this clearance, a coupled analysis model for leakage and dynamic behavior of the orbiting scroll is made, and analyzed by iterative calculation. By regarding clearances of main, sub bearing of crankshaft and orbiting scroll shaft bearing clearance as design parameters, the radial clearance of scroll wraps is analyzed.

  • Flexure bearings have been used in linear-resonant compressors to maintain a non-contacting clearance seal between the piston and cylinder. There are two types of tangential cantilever bearing and spiral arm bearing with flexure bearings. A newly devised linear flexure bearing (KIMM-Ml) for compression refrigeration machines is disclosed having improved tight gas clearance maintaining capability for better system performance. KIMM-Ml is an integrated device comprising an axially moving diaphragm with circumferentially arranged arc-shaped flexure blades secured between rim and hub spacers, which turn out to have higher radial stiffness than the one with circumferential tangential cantilever flexure blades. It is expected for KIMM-Ml to play a key role in designing long life, special purpose compression refrigeration machines by providing frictionless, non-wearing, linear movement and radial support for the machines as well as a gas clearance seal by maintaining extremely tight clearances between piston and cylinder.

  • This paper presents a quasi-3-dimensional calculation method considering secondary flows in the impellers of diagonal flow blowers. A Quantitative estimation of the secondary flow effects is made by using secondary flow theories. In order to verify the validity of the adopted models, that is, span-wise mixing model and the tip clearance model, numerical simulations are performed for two different types of impellers of diagonal flow blowers which are designed differently. Numerical experiments are conducted for each of a constant tangential velocity type impeller, and a free vortex type impeller, both at two different flow coefficients. According to the simulation results, it was found that the present model considering span-wise mixing and tip clearance effect shows better agreements with the experimental data than those without these models in terms of the flow velocity and the angle distribution.

  • Currently, a new generation of ducted fan UAVs (Unmanned Aerial Vehicles) is under development for a wide range of inspection, investigation and combat missions as well as for a variety of civil roles like traffic monitoring, meteorological studies, hazard mitigation etc. The current study presents extensive results obtained experimentally in order to investigate the tip clearance effects on performance characteristics of a ducted fan for small UAV systems. Three ducted fans having different tip clearance gap and with same rotor size were examined under three different yawed conditions of calibrated slanted hot-wire probe. Three dimensional velocity flow fields were measured from hub to tip at outlet of the ducted fan. The analysis of data were done by PLEAT (Phase locked Ensemble Averaging Technique) and three non-linear differential equations were solved simultaneously by using Newton -Rhapson numerical method. Flow field characteristics such as tip vortex and secondary flow were confirmed through axial, radial and tangential velocity contour plots. At the same time, the effects of tip clearance on axial thrust and input power were also investigated by using wind tunnel measurement system. For enhancing the performance of ducted fan, tip clearance level should be as small as possible.

  • Pressures in compression pockets consists of two identical spiral scrolls are influenced by gas flow resistance in discharge process and leakages in radial and tangential directions between two scroll wraps. In this paper, considering geometrical characteristics of these members, flow resistance and refrigerant gas leakage losses, pressure variations in compression pockets are calculated. For a scroll compressor model with fixed crank mechanism, acting load on crankshaft is analyzed. And, for a vertical type crankshaft-journal bearing system used in scroll compressor, nonlinear transient response is calculated including nonlinear fluid film reaction forces of journal bearings.

  • The stability of a rotor-bearing system supported by swirl-controlled hybrid journal bearing with pair-type angled injection orifices is investigated for improvement of the whirl frequency ratio by allowing effective control of the tangential flow inside the bearing clearance, i.e., by achieving more freedom in controlling strength and direction of the supply tangential flow inside the bearing clearance. It is suggested that the system instability can be improved through the change of bearing dynamic characteristic parameters with the swirl control. The orifice diameter d$_0$ and recess injection angle $\alpha$ along with combinations of swirl/anti-swirl supply pressures and directions (3.0-3.0MPa, 4.0-2.0MPa, 2.0-4.0MPa) are selected for design parameters for swirl-controlled effective factors dependent on journal speeds (3000, 9000, 15000, 21000 rpm). It has been found that the orifice diameter do shows strong effects on effective maneuverability of direct-stiffness and direct damping values, while recess injection angle $\alpha$ results in substantial magnitude and direction of cross-stiffness. Specifically, recess injection parameters which are functions of angle of orifice feeding flow and recess dimensions showed very feasible effect on the stability of swirl-controlled rotor-bearing system.

  • As the tangential flow inside the clearance of tribe elements such as bearings and seals is increased as the shaft speed increases, the system stability will be decreased due to the increment of the instability parameter. To reduce the tangential flow inside the clearance of the balance sleeve, anti-swirl injection mechanism is applied. The balance sleeve is used in resisting the axial force induced by impeller in high pressure multi-stage pump. In this paper, total three cases are experimentally investigated; original balance steeve, anti-swirl injection balance steeve with 0 axial degree and anti-swirl injection balance sleeve with 30 axial degree. Experiments are focused in the comparison of vibration level and leakage flow rate. The results clearly shows that the anti-swirl injection balance sleeve with 0 axial degree improves the vibration characteristics. However, the anti-swirl injection balance sleeve with 30 degree aggravates the vibration characteristics. In the standpoint of leakage performance, both anti-swirl injection balance sleeves show the better result than the original balance sleeve.
